Humane Society of Sarasota County Inc is Hiring a Veterinarian Near Sarasota, FL

Founded in 1952, the Humane Society of Sarasota County (HSSC) is Sarasota?s oldest animal welfare organization. In 2009, HSSC became a no-kill shelter and with the completion of our shelter expansion and renovation project in 2021, HSSC is now the area?s premier no-kill organization. At the heart of our mission is the core belief that every animal is cared for and loved.
We are seeking a compassionate and passionate veterinarian dedicated to helping animals in the community that would benefit from our care. In all that we do, HSSC holds true to our mission to save every dog or cat in our care that can be saved. Our core values reflect a commitment to transparency and accountability to our community. In all our interactions with our community, we want to present ourselves as welcoming to the community and helpful. We are committed to kindness and compassion to our team and aim to create a workplace culture that embraces diversity and in which everyone feels respected and valued.
Responsibilities Include:
? Develop a rapport with clients and determine their needs and wishes; perform
physical examinations and diagnostic/medical/surgical/dental procedures in a
way that will deliver the highest quality care while minimizing patient stress and
discomfort.
? Explain physical examination findings and communicate to the client a diagnosis
of the pet?s problems; generate and present a treatment plan for the pet to the
client; educate clients on spay/neuter, preventative health care, including
vaccines and appropriate nutritional products.
? Maintain client, patient, and medical and surgical records, and make certain all
necessary logs are kept up-to-date through established protocols; assist
colleagues in follow-up and future management of the patient.
? Stay up-to-date with new medical information and changes in veterinary
medicine, attend Continuing Education meetings.
? Positively represent the Animal Clinic and HSSC in the professional community
and to the general public.
? A commitment to providing affordable, accessible veterinary care and offering
products and services in keeping with a commitment to low-cost veterinary care.
? Treat all patients and clients with care and compassion, remembering that the
patient?s wellbeing is the top priority.
? Review patient records for completeness and accuracy and use as a tool to
promote medical excellence.
? Regularly discuss cases with doctors and/or staff to optimize patient care.
? Encourage all staff to increase knowledge through learning opportunities.
? Perform routine spay and neuter surgical procedures and some dentistry.
Generous Compensation Package:
$120,000 starting salary
Employer match 401(k)
Dental insurance
Employee discount
Employee Assistance Program
Flexible spending account
Health insurance
Four Weeks Paid time off.
Ten Paid Holidays
Professional development assistance
Tuition Reimbursement
HSSC is a non-profit organization, and you may be eligible for the Public Service Loan Forgiveness Program
